WebPORT STATE SERVICE 135/tcp open msrpc Nmap done: 2 IP addresses (2 hosts up) scanned in 0.04 seconds use CIDR-style addressing – you can use the CIDR notation to … WebFeb 12, 2024 · An IP address uniquely identifies a device on a network. You’ve seen these addresses before; they look something like 192.168.1.34. An IP address is always a set of four numbers like that. Each number can range from 0 to 255. So, the full IP addressing range goes from 0.0.0.0 to 255.255.255.255. daewoo microwave red https://roosterscc.com

WebAug 3, 2024 · The ability to specify IP address ranges in policy was added in SGOS 6.5.2. This feature allows you to enter a range as follows: 198.51.100.0-198.51.100.255. Example Use Case. You are an administrator of a retailer's distributed network. The network is very large and has numerous sub-networks, in which IP address ranges are non-contiguous … WebJun 27, 2024 · To change your public IP address on a Windows PC, go to Control Panel > Network and Sharing Center > Change Adapter Settings, and choose the connection. WebMar 28, 2024 · If you’re trying to determine the class of an IP address, you need to look at the first number. If the first number is 1 through 127, it’ll be a class A address. If the first number is 128 through 191, it’s a class B …

WebSep 10, 2024 · If your ISP address range is 98.0.0.0 - 98.15.255.255 it means that the first 12 bits of the address is their networkblock and the last 20 bits they can assign to hosts or …
